No Waiver of Sovereign Immunity; Public Liability Strictly Limited. Nothing in this Agreement shall be construed or deemed to constitute a waiver of the City’s Sovereign Immunity. The Parties agree that in no event shall the City, or any of its officials, officers, agents, attorneys, employees, or representatives have any liability in damages or any other monetary liability to the Developer or any lessee, sublessee, assign, heir or personal representative of the Developer in respect of any suit, claim, or cause of action arising out of this Agreement.
